DescriptionLocationInstructors This class is designed to give the Florida real estate licensee an in-depth introduction to fair housing laws. The objectives of this course are designed to give the attendee a solid foundation to understanding the Florida and federal fair housing laws as applied in day-to-day real estate. Additionally, the course is highlights the dos and don'ts as they relate to fair housing. Topics discussed: - Fair housing definitions - Discrimination in housing - Federal fair housing laws - Americans with Disabilities Act (ADA) - Florida fair housing laws - Fair housing and advertising - Fair housing enforcement - Safe fair housing practices Seating is limited and registration is REQUIRED.
